Parents of teen lost to sudden cardiac arrest host free heart screenings in San Diego County

Hector and Rhina Paredes lost their 15-year-old son, Eric, to sudden cardiac arrest in 2009. Now, they are raising awareness about sudden cardiac arrest in youth to prevent the tragedy from affecting other families in the community.
